Abbreviations: T= Teaching, P= Practice, ECTS credit | No. of Courses | 42 | |
Total Credits Required for Graduation | 240 | Minimum ECTS Credits for Applied / Practical Component of the Curriculum | 60 |
Total Credits of Electives | 66 | Elective Ratio | 27.50% |
- 5 or 6 Program Electives are taken from Table 2. Other junior, senior or graduate level courses may be taken as program elective with Program Coordinator's consent
- 2 Free Elective courses are taken from any program in any faculty.
- Work placement/Internship is typically practiced in summer for a period of at least 25 work days, amounting to a minimum of 150 hours.
- 2 University Electives are taken from Table 2.
- In exceptional cases only, Faculty council may make a decision for a student bypass a prerequisite for any course.
- 2 Language Elective courses are taken from the list of language courses provided (can not be the student's mother language).

- 5xx level ECON, MAN or IBF courses as well as IE program courses at IUS can be taken as program elective with the consent of the Program Coordinator.
- Junior standing: The students must have completed at least 108 ECTS successfully.
- Senior standing: The students must have completed at least 168 ECTS successfully.
